
1957 Chevrolet 2 Dr. BelAir hardtop fuel injected 283 cubic inch V/8, 250 HP with Power glide transmission and a 3:55 rear end. The car is as it came from factory, with the correct exterior colors of Onyx Black and India Ivory White top and the red and Black interior # 676. This is a fairly early production car with a VIN number of VC 57N181268 this car was built in Norwood, Ohio around the second week of April. All of the Numbers match the date that it was built or close to it. The motor is number is F402FJ built April 2nd The heads Numbers are 3731539, March, made in flint. The fuel injection unit is number 1395 a part Number 7014520 built in April. The glass date AS-2-2MT7 February 1957 Clear.
There were a total of 1,530 Chevrolets built in 1957 with the RPO-5789 Fuel injection between March 6th and September 30th. Only 1040 BelAir cars were sold with the new Fuel Injection and only 524 BelAir 2dr hardtops.
I had known about this 1957 Chevrolet for many years and when I was finally able to get the car a full restoration was started. The suspension parts, motor, fuel injection unit, transmission, rear end, fuel lines, gas tank and electrical wiring were rebuilt or replaced. New sway bars front and rear and Bilstien Shocks were installed. The car was completely disassembled and strip to bare metal. The frame and underbody were cleaned and re-painted. The body was painted with base coat and many coats of clear. Then many hours of color sanding and rubbing and polishing. New date coded glass, stainless, chrome, new rubber seals and new interior where installed. All of the gauges have been cleaned and rebuilt. The car has new correct size radial tires.
All of the restoration was done by the former owner of the Auto Shop. The Auto Shop, among many other awards also has won over 14 awards at Pebble Beach including 9 first in class awards. The Fuel injection was rebuilt by Gary Hodges of Oregon the interior by Stitches located in Washington and all of the mechanical was done by Ron Graham.
This car was shown in 2015 at the 44th Pacific NW Vintage Chevrolet Club of America Meet and scored 997 points out of 1000 winning 1st Place. Also was awarded Best of the Meet , People Choice and Best of Show V/8 which made the car eligible for the National Best of the Best for 2015. My car drives and handles like a new car
